Microsoft has released Windows 11 Insider Preview Build 27902 for users in the Canary Channel, bringing a set of enhancements and fixes aimed at refining the user experience. This update addresses specific issues with File Explorer and the Camera app, which were causing usability problems for some Insiders.
In this latest build, users can expect improvements that enhance overall system performance and reliability. Notably, the update resolves a persistent bug in File Explorer that prevented view changes from being saved and affected the arrangement of desktop icons. Additionally, a fix has been implemented for the Camera app, which had been experiencing freezing issues during camera switching on certain PCs.
The announcement includes options for downloading ISOs for this build, allowing users to easily access the latest features and improvements.
